Harvest Park / Sage Creek median real estate price is $507,064, which is more expensive than 53.6% of the neighborhoods in Colorado and 76.2% of the neighborhoods in the U.S.
The average rental price in Harvest Park / Sage Creek is currently $2,615, based on NeighborhoodScout's exclusive analysis. The average rental cost in this neighborhood is higher than 73.4% of the neighborhoods in Colorado.
Harvest Park / Sage Creek is a suburban neighborhood (based on population density) located in Fort Collins, Colorado.
Harvest Park / Sage Creek real estate is primarily made up of medium sized (three or four bedroom) to large (four, five or more bedroom) single-family homes and townhomes. Most of the residential real estate is owner occupied. Many of the residences in the Harvest Park / Sage Creek neighborhood are established but not old, having been built between 1970 and 1999. A number of residences were also built between 2000 and the present.
In Harvest Park / Sage Creek, the current vacancy rate is 0.7%, which is a lower rate of vacancies than 92.9% of all neighborhoods in the U.S. This means that the housing supply in Harvest Park / Sage Creek is very tight compared to the demand for property here.

The neighbors in the Harvest Park / Sage Creek neighborhood in Fort Collins are upper-middle income, making it an above average income neighborhood. NeighborhoodScout's exclusive analysis reveals that this neighborhood has a higher income than 83.3% of the neighborhoods in America. In addition, 2.1% of the children seventeen and under living in this neighborhood are living below the federal poverty line, which is a lower rate of childhood poverty than is found in 75.8% of America's neighborhoods.

In the Harvest Park / Sage Creek neighborhood, 53.5% of the working population is employed in executive, management, and professional occupations. The second most important occupational group in this neighborhood is sales and service jobs, from major sales accounts, to working in fast food restaurants, with 23.2% of the residents employed. Other residents here are employed in clerical, assistant, and tech support occupations (14.0%), and 8.8% in manufacturing and laborer occupations.

In the Harvest Park / Sage Creek neighborhood in Fort Collins, CO, residents most commonly identify their ethnicity or ancestry as German (23.3%). There are also a number of people of English ancestry (19.8%), and residents who report Irish roots (18.1%), and some of the residents are also of Mexican ancestry (11.5%), along with some French ancestry residents (9.2%), among others. In addition, 10.2% of the residents of this neighborhood were born in another country.

The greatest number of commuters in Harvest Park / Sage Creek neighborhood spend between 15 and 30 minutes commuting one-way to work (45.4% of working residents), which is shorter than the time spent commuting to work for most Americans.
Here most residents (91.6%) drive alone in a private automobile to get to work. In addition, quite a number also carpool with coworkers, friends, or neighbors to get to work (6.5%) . In a neighborhood like this, as in most of the nation, many residents find owning a car useful for getting to work.
